MSc Cybersecurity Management and Consulting – ESIEA and Skema
The MSc Cybersecurity Management and Consulting is a dual-degree program delivered by SKEMA Business School and ESIEA. It combines advanced cybersecurity expertise with consulting and leadership skills to prepare graduates to manage cyber risks and support organizations in a complex digital world.
Key information
Degree awarded
A master of science degree and the “Diploma of Specialised Studies in International Management“ (DESMI), a degree approved by France’s Ministry of Higher Education and Research (master’s level. – RNCP N°41056)
Location
Paris
Admission level
4-year university degree or equivalent + two months minimum of professional experience (or internship)
Degree
Five-year degree (Master’s level)
Program duration
1 year
Type of programme
Full-time
Intake
September
Tuition fees
€25,000
Language
Fully taught in English
Where Cybersecurity, Governance, and Strategic Consulting converge.
This MSc is delivered in close collaboration with SKEMA Business School, combining ESIEA’s engineering and cybersecurity expertise with SKEMA’s strengths in management, consulting, and global business. Together, the two institutions offer a complementary approach that prepares graduates to bridge technical excellence with strategic decision-making.
This programme equips students to :
- Understand and anticipate evolving cyber threats
- Design robust governance frameworks aligned with business objectives
- Lead consulting engagements that drive compliance, risk management, and digital transformation
- Develop leadership capabilities essential for managing cybersecurity initiatives in diverse organizational settings
Why Choose This Programme?
Double Degree Excellence
Consulting-Centric Curriculum
Unique GRC & Insurance Focus
Leadership Development
Career Coaching & Networking
Global Market Relevance
Course content
Semester 1 at Campus SKEMA Grand Paris
Semester 2 at Campus ESIEA
Core Courses
- Prerequisites for Managers
- Prerequisites for Engineers
- Organizational Dynamics, 1 crédit
- Project Management Fundamentals, 2 crédits
- Business Consulting Fundamentals, 2 crédits
- Introduction to Financial Analysis, 1 crédit
- Cyber Threats & Vulnerabilities, 2 crédits
- Data Security & Cryptography Principles, 1 crédit
- Strategic Management & Formulation, 2 crédits
- Preparing for Consulting Interview, 3 crédits
- Organizational Governance, 2 crédits
- Cyber Law & Compliance, 2 crédits
- Risk Assessment & Impact Analysis, 2 crédits
- Career Management 1, 1 crédit
TOTAL CREDITS SEMESTRE 1: 21 CREDITS
Core courses
- System & Application Security, 3 crédits
- Incident Response & Digital Forensics 3 crédits
- Digital Innovation & Transformation, 2 crédits
- Consulting Simulation, 2 crédits
- Cybersecurity Strategy Development, 3 crédits
- Crisis Management & Recovery, 2 crédits
- Cyber Insurance, 3 crédits
- Leadership Principles (Harvard), 1 crédit
- Strategy Execution (Harvard), 1 crédit
- Career Management 2, 1 crédits
TOTAL CREDITS SEMESTRE 2: 21 CREDITS
Mémoire : 18 crédits
TOTAL ANNEE COMPLETE : 60 CREDITS
Career opportunities
Graduates are prepared for diverse, strategic roles in cybersecurity, governance, risk, compliance, consulting, and insurance sectors, including :
- Cybersecurity Consultant (GRC & Advisory)
- Risk & Compliance Analyst
- Governance & Audit Specialist
- Cyber Strategy Manager
- Data Protection Officer (DPO)
- Cyber Insurance Advisor
These positions are in strong demand within consulting firms, major corporations, financial institutions, and public sector organizations in France and abroad. The integration of cyber insurance highlights the growing need for specialists capable of handling cyber risk transfer and insurance solutions, enhancing traditional GRC advisory and leadership functions.
Interview
How to apply
You can contact directly the director of the programme at ESIEA :
bassem.haidar@esiea.fr